Re: Mars WILL ALTER ISON'S Orbit!
ISON will encounter Mars near directly over the north pole on Oct 1st. NASA's JPL, and indeed all orbital diagrams relied upon do not factor planetary encounter circumstances!
 Quoting: Kalki 12772450

Wrong. The java applet intended for quick preview purposes on the JPL site does not factor planetary encounters, it's just a 2 body simulation, but that does not mean "ALL orbital diagrams relied upon" fail to account for it. Just because the typical youtube ISON doomer doesn't know how to use anything more advanced than the java applet does not mean that no one else does. Indeed, JPL's HORIZONS system factors it in as do a number of programs that amateurs can run on their own computers. FindOrb and ORSA being two of my personal favorites.

Re: Mars WILL ALTER ISON'S Orbit!
Don't know about the mars encounter causing ISON to hit earth, but it is rather interesting how the orbit takes it within 7m km... This type of encounter is the same thing we do with space probes to adjust their orbits.
 Quoting: Billy_Sastard

Where did you get these numbers? University of YouTube?

E.g. Voyager 1 passed Jupiter at a distance of 349,000 kilometers and Saturn at 124,000 kilometers to gain speed and change the orbit.

A little difference to your 7 million kilometers, isn't it?
